Abstract

As a consequence of extensive morphological and molecular research in Lampranthus and its allies, a new genus, Ruschiella Klak, is erected to accommodate a small group of anomalous species. Lampranthus uncus var. gydouwensis, previously regarded as a synonym of Phiambolia unca is raised to the rank of species, as Phiambolia gydouwensis (L. Bolus) Klak. Phyllobolus herbertii (N.E. Br.) Gerbaulet has been found to be conspecific with P. abbreviatus (L. Bolus) Gerbaulet. A new combination is made for Sphalmanthus humilis L. Bolus, as Phyllobolus humilis (L. Bolus) Klak, which had erroneously been treated as a synonym of P. herbertii. The taxonomic position of Lampranthus mutatus (G.D. Rowley) H.E.K. Hartmann is discussed and it is argued that this species is best placed in Ruschia, as Ruschia mutata G.D. Rowley.
